Aerobic exercise involves any kind of movement that will increase your heart rate and causes your lungs to demand additional oxygen. Typical activities that are good for aerobic exercise include running, jogging, swimming and dancing. As you progress your major muscle groups, your body demands additional oxygen and your heart beats faster. Aerobic exercise improves your circulation and exercises the most necessary muscle in your body - your heart.
It is suggested that you simply exercise aerobically for at least thirty minutes per week, 3 times per week. Additionally, if you've got a sedentary job, you should guarantee that you regularly get up and move around to avoid problems that can arise from sitting still for too long. If you're currently unfit, you should build up to thirty minutes per week gradually. Starting with 5 to ten minute sessions and gradually increasing the length and intensity of your workout from there.

Getting to Your Personal Best
It's vital to repeatedly challenge your body aerobically. Once you get match and have a regular routine, your body can begin to adapt to the exercise regime and you'll find it tougher and tougher to keep your heart rate up and find a high intensity workout. Vigorous exercise and exercising for a extended amount of your time can ensure that you just maintain your fitness levels. Conjointly, enjoying a sport or mixing up your fitness activities will be a nice what to spice up your fitness levels.
Diet
Diet plays a pivotal role in making certain that you simply derive the utmost edges from your exercise routine. Create sure that you simply eat healthily and drink tons of water. Eat fruit and vegetables and keep you intake of sugar and saturated fat to a clean minimum. By eating a varied and healthy diet, you will be able to lose weight and shape up fast.
